Duke sues QB Darian Mensah to keep him from transferring


Duke University sued star quarterback Darian Mensah on Tuesday, seeking to stop him from entering the transfer portal and playing for another school next season. A judge in the case is expected to deny Duke's request for a temporary restraining order restricting Mensah from the move, Darren Heitner — a lawyer for Mensah — told WRAL on Tuesday. (WRAL.com)
